#280796 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#280796 is composed of 15.7% red, 2.7%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 253.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 30.8%. #280796 color hex could be obtained by blending #500eff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#280796 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#280796 has RGB values of R:40, G:7,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 2623382.

Shades and Tints of #280796
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0ecf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#280796
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4954 is the less saturated color, while #25019c is the most saturated one.
